Abstract :
This paper proposes a general framework to develop SCORM compliant courses that provide adaptation according to user learning style. The SCORM standard as well as some of the most popular learning style models and adaptive systems that implement them are briefly presented. The general framework is introduced and a case study with some evaluation outcomes is discussed.
